Concerns raised over irregularities in e-passport tender process
Posté

KATHMANDU: Allegations of serious irregularities have surfaced regarding Nepal’s recent international tender process for electronic passports (e-passports). The Department of Passports, under the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, is being accused of bypassing the legal procurement process while handling two key tenders related to passport printing and data management systems.
